Can anybody please tell me how many pictures I can burn on a CD ?
I have purchased a CD - RW 700 MB - 80 minutes I am a total beginner. Thank you Schweig |
||
|
|
"Frequent Traveller" Power Member |
It depends on the size of your pictures.
As you say yourself, a CD holds 700MB of data. If you have, say, a 4 or 5 MPixel camera, a typical picture will probably be about 2MB in size, in which case a CD will hold about 700/2 = 350 pictures. One thing, by the way. I notice you said that you bought CD-RW disks. I would strongly urge you _not_ to use CD-RWs. Although the ability to erase them may seem attractive, they are _much_ more fragile than plain single-use CD-Rs, and are _not_ a good thing to use for long-term data storage. Use normal CD-R disks. Their cost is trivial, and your pictures will be a _lot_ safer! Regards, Chris |

One point that's perhaps worth making is that, although CD-R disks are a "write once" medium, you don't have to write everything to them in one go. You can write a few pictures to a CD, then come back and write more to that same CD, then more, etc, until the CD is full up.
